My car is whole again-Thanks EVOMS and Rennsport One!

It's whole and better than ever! Not gonna rehash my entire Bilstein suspension fiasco located here:
https://www.6speedonline.com/forums/...nsors+bilstein

First off, let me thank Justin at Rennsport One for hooking me up with a set of KW Variant 3 coilovers (in addition to some cosmetic bits which I hope are on the way).
And thanks to Ian, Josh and Robert at Evolution Motorsports for cranking out the install and alignment in one day as promised.

Ever since I've had the Bilstein Damptronics, it's been one headache after another. Hours, days, weeks wasted with the car in the shop and thousands of dollars in the toilet. I'm going to reserve my final opinions on this company pending them taking back the brand new but completely useless $700 shock I purchased.

More importantly, it was a mod that was meant to improve the performance and overall enjoyment of the car. It failed miserably on both counts. Having just returned from a roadtrip to Southern California, I found myself cursing, and dare I say it, HATE the car because it was just not fun to drive. Felt like I was riding on solid axles and wooden wheels. And while I'm sure they were correctly installed with those silly little washers, ever since dkbrent's catastrophic failures, I have always felt more than a bit uneasy, particularly with my wife in the car.

Enter KW's. Have to thank (or curse) Mike (GotBoost?) for his very wise words: chalk up the Bilsteins as a lesson (albeit an expensive one) and don't waste anymore time, money, and effort trying to fix them. Failed once, shame on Bilstein, failed twice, shame on me. Wasn't going for a third go around.
All I can say is.....wow. Perhaps some of my initial impressions are based on the fact that I've been riding on completely noncompliant shocks for the last 3 months, but the difference is night and day. The progressive V3 springs give an extremely comfortable ride. Combined with the RSS sways (installed the first time around), the car is now truly point-and-go with minimal/no body roll. And now with Sport Mode back, I once again have the improved throttle response which I've been without since the Bilsteins went on.

Kind of strange to have the little 'shock' button on the console nonfunctional, but to anyone contemplating this mod, you won't miss it.
